Here Is What Is Actually Happening in Your Body
Your weight is managed by a network of hormones - leptin, ghrelin, insulin, cortisol, thyroid hormones, estrogen, testosterone, and GLP-1 - that regulate hunger, satiety, fat storage, energy expenditure, and metabolic rate. When any part of this network is off, the equation changes in ways that no amount of discipline corrects.
Leptin resistance means the brain does not receive the signal that you are full. You eat the right amount and feel hungry an hour later.
Insulin resistance means cells are not efficiently using glucose for energy. Instead it gets stored as fat - particularly around the abdomen. Exercise helps, but if insulin signaling is impaired, the fat storage mechanism keeps running regardless.
GLP-1 deficiency means the hormone that slows gastric emptying and signals satiety is either not being produced adequately or not being responded to effectively. You eat a full meal and feel the same 45 minutes later.
Hormonal decline in estrogen, progesterone, or testosterone shifts body composition directly. Muscle mass decreases. Fat redistributes to the abdomen. The body that responds to effort in your 30s does not respond the same way in your 40s because it is literally a different hormonal environment.
Metabolic adaptation is the body's response to caloric restriction - it reduces energy expenditure to match. The diet that worked at week two produces nothing at week eight, not because you did something wrong but because your body adapted to preserve itself. This is evolutionary biology, not personal failure.
Why the Standard Advice Does Not Work for Everyone
The standard advice was designed for a population average. It does not account for individual hormonal variation, genetic predisposition to insulin resistance, gut microbiome differences, or the specific hormonal environment of someone in perimenopause, andropause, or chronic stress.
If you are someone for whom the standard approach has failed repeatedly, the problem is not the approach in isolation - it is that the approach is being applied without first understanding the biological environment it is working against.

Medical Weight Loss - GLP-1 Receptor Agonists (Semaglutide)
GLP-1 receptor agonists mimic the action of GLP-1 - the hormone that signals satiety and slows gastric emptying. Branded semaglutide (Wegovy) produced average weight reductions of 10 to 15% of body weight in clinical trials over approximately 68 weeks. These outcomes are produced by correcting a biological signal, not stricter willpower. Can hormones cause weight gain?
Yes. Estrogen and progesterone decline shifts fat distribution toward the abdomen. Testosterone decline reduces the muscle mass that drives metabolic rate. Thyroid dysfunction slows overall metabolic function. For clients whose weight started changing in their 40s without a clear lifestyle explanation, a comprehensive hormonal assessment is the appropriate starting point.
